Account recovery — Sketchline diagram editor. Undo/redo state lives client-side; a locked account does not lose history, so don't panic users. Steps: verify the requester owns the workspace, suspend active sessions, trigger the recovery flow from the Glimmerport admin panel. Undo stack survives recovery; redo stack is cleared on re-auth — expected behavior, not a bug. Do not hand-edit the session table. If the admin panel itself is locked out, use the break-glass passphrase below.

vault phrase of tajop-haduf = holath-brivan-wenax

Hey — handing off the Lintbarrow baseline file before I rotate to the Quellport team. The baseline pins every pre-existing static-analysis warning in the Fernwick codebase, so new PRs only fail on fresh issues. Don't regenerate it casually; Marek learned that the hard way last sprint. If you do need a rebuild, run the snapshot job on a clean branch and commit the diff separately. The analyzer reads its settings from the block below.

service settings:
[casax]
port = 6379
team = rusir
host = casax.zemvarhq.corp
region = outer-4
access_code = ac_9808ce
timeout_ms = 1500

MEMO — Records Team. The 2009–2014 paper ledgers are boxed and ready for transfer to the Thornefield archive facility. Boxes are labelled, sealed, and logged in the register. A courier from Marrowgate Transit collects them Friday morning. Do not open any box after sealing. The courier hand-over instruction is as follows:

handover note for yagef-bagep: the drudor pelius courier leaves the kasdor zorvan norir ledger at gate 8016 under passcode 755406